Hey JF, Pavel, We're still seeing crashes due to SIGPIPE on some lldb bots. This workaround in the lldb driver is insufficient, because liblldb.dylib may install its own a fresh set of llvm signal handlers (the `NumRegisteredSignals` global is not shared by all images loaded in a process). Here is a trace that illustrates the issue: https://gist.github.com/vedantk/2d0cc1df9bea9f0fa74ee101d240b82c.
I think we should fix this by changing llvm's default behavior: let's have it ignore SIGPIPE. Driver programs (like clang, dwarfdump, etc.) can then opt-in to exiting when SIGPIPE is received. Wdyt? Some alternatives include: - Add a static initializer to liblldb.dylib that copies the workaround in the driver. This should work fine, but it's a duct tape on top of a bandaid. - Have the dynamic linker coalesce all copies of `NumRegisteredSignals` in a process.
